In a civilized community, it is no big deal for a person not to misbehave. But in an uncivilized community, it is normal for a person to misbehave so when a person does not misbehave, he must be commended. In fact, care must be exercised not to provoke him to change his behaving to misbehaving. The assumption behind the commendations for Akufo Addo is that, Africa is an uncivilized community so it is not normal for someone who has lost at the Supreme Court to accept he has lost. Akufo is a "hero" by accepting the rule of the Supreme Court and congratulating President Mahama.
But for the fact that Akufo Addo is operating in an uncivilized Africa, he should have been condemned for wasting 8 precious months for Ghanaians.
Akufo Addo had no better time to concede defeat and congratulate President Mahama than 9th December 2012 when the EC declared President Mahama winner of the election.
All the numerous observers local and international including the media said with one voice that the elections were free, fair and transparent but Akufo Addo's NPP had other ideas.
Akufo Addo claimed there was rigging. Even when they assembled the pink sheets and noticed no rigging, they refused to repent. They changed the claim to six items: 1. some pink sheets unsigned, 2. some people voted without biometric verification, 3. some pink sheets had duplicate serial numbers, 4. some pink sheets had the same codes, 5. there were over-voting at some places and 6. there were unknown polling stations.
As a result, they wanted almost 5 million votes to be annulled and demanded to be declared winner based on the remaining votes.
The SC verdict is very decisive. All the 9 judges rejected 3 of the claims while the other 3 claims were rejected by a majority decision. Even the minority of the judges who did not reject 3 of the claims refused to annul the votes concerned for Akufo Addo to declared winner. What they said was that, the election should be re-run in the polling stations concerned. If this were to be done, everybody knows that, these are Mahama's strongholds and the result will not be anything different from the first result Akufo Addo rejected.
Those who think the SC can declare someone winner of an election should use this judgment to revise their notes.
